On rice, F. moniliforme induces seedling elongation, foot rot, seedling rot, grain sterility, and grain discoloration (11). The pathogen can be both seed-borne and soilborne. Generally, the seed-borne inoculum provides initial foci for secondary infection. Under favorable environmental conditions, infected plants in different foci have the capacity to produce numerous conidia that subsequently infect proximate healthy plants, which results in yield loss
